如何在 ArcGIS 中創建 SDE 數據庫?
在地理信息系統(GIS)中,ArcGIS 是一個廣泛使用的工具,特別是在處理空間數據時。SDE(Spatial Database Engine)是 ArcGIS 的一個重要組件,允許用戶將地理數據存儲在關係數據庫中,並提供高效的數據管理和查詢功能。本文將介紹如何在 ArcGIS 中創建 SDE 數據庫的步驟。
1. 確認系統要求
在開始之前,您需要確保您的系統符合以下要求:
- 安裝 ArcGIS Desktop 或 ArcGIS Pro。
- 安裝支持的關係數據庫管理系統(RDBMS),如 Oracle、SQL Server 或 PostgreSQL。
- 擁有相應的數據庫用戶權限,以便創建數據庫和用戶。
2. 安裝 SDE
首先,您需要安裝 ArcGIS 的 SDE 組件。這通常在安裝 ArcGIS Desktop 或 ArcGIS Pro 時自動完成。如果您需要單獨安裝,請遵循以下步驟:
- 下載 ArcGIS 的安裝包。
- 運行安裝程序,並選擇 SDE 組件進行安裝。
3. 創建數據庫
在您的 RDBMS 中創建一個新的數據庫。以下是一些常見數據庫的創建示例:
在 Oracle 中創建數據庫
CREATE USER sde IDENTIFIED BY password;
GRANT CONNECT, RESOURCE TO sde;在 SQL Server 中創建數據庫
CREATE DATABASE SDE;
GO
CREATE LOGIN sde WITH PASSWORD = 'password';
GO
CREATE USER sde FOR LOGIN sde;在 PostgreSQL 中創建數據庫
CREATE DATABASE sde;
CREATE USER sde WITH PASSWORD 'password';
GRANT ALL PRIVILEGES ON DATABASE sde TO sde;4. 配置 SDE 連接
接下來,您需要配置 SDE 連接。這可以通過 ArcGIS 的“ArcCatalog”或“Catalog”窗口來完成:
- 打開 ArcCatalog。
- 右鍵單擊“Database Connections”,選擇“Add Database Connection”。
- 選擇您的數據庫類型,並輸入連接信息,包括數據庫名稱、用戶名和密碼。
- 測試連接以確保一切正常。
- 點擊“OK”以保存連接。
5. 註冊 SDE 數據庫
在 ArcGIS 中,您需要註冊 SDE 數據庫以便使用:
- 在 ArcCatalog 中,右鍵單擊您的數據庫連接,選擇“Register with Geodatabase”。
- 選擇要註冊的數據類型(如要素類、表等)。
- 完成註冊後,您可以開始在 SDE 數據庫中創建和管理地理數據。
6. 測試和驗證
最後,您應該測試您的 SDE 數據庫以確保其正常運行。您可以通過創建一個簡單的要素類並進行查詢來驗證:
arcpy.CreateFeatureclass_management("Database Connections/your_connection.sde", "test_feature_class", "POINT")如果沒有錯誤,則表示您的 SDE 數據庫已成功創建並可以使用。
總結
在 ArcGIS 中創建 SDE 數據庫是一個相對簡單的過程,只需遵循上述步驟即可完成。通過將地理數據存儲在 SDE 數據庫中,您可以更有效地管理和查詢數據,從而提高工作效率。如果您需要進一步的支持或尋找合適的 VPS 解決方案來運行您的 GIS 應用程序,請訪問我們的網站以獲取更多信息。